Web28 mrt. 2024 · “Emerging Contaminants” Under ASTM E1527-21. The new ASTM E1527-21 standard recognizes that certain contaminants of interest might not (or not yet) be defined as hazardous substances under CERCLA. Some of these contaminants might be considered hazardous under state laws, or may be expected to be federally regulated in the future.
